Role Purpose
The Senior Manager ensures the teams successful delivery and people outcomes by orchestrating capacity and workload planning maintaining delivery quality managing performance and development supporting hiring and the junior program and acting as the first line for escalations.
In addition the role requires senior-level SAP project management expertise to lead and oversee complex SAP implementation or enhancement projects ensure adherence to methodology manage risks support solution quality and act as a senior advisor to the professional team and stakeholders.
Responsibilities
People & Performance
- Run monthly 1:1s (3060 minutes) to provide feedback coaching and support.
- Track consultant work quality and quantity throughout the year.
- Discuss quarterly/annual performance with the manager; propose development and HR steps.
- Drive annual evaluation sessions for colleagues (as requested by manager).
- Support team members with day-to-day issues (e.g. travel admin topics sick leave).
- Maintain awareness of personal circumstances where relevant to planning and support.
- Mentor SAP consultants and act as a senior expert in SAP-related delivery topics.
Capacity Workload & Resource Planning
- Maintain an accurate view of current workload and consultant capacities.
- Proactively prepare workload planning for upcoming periods.
- Suggest candidates for specific staffing requests and propose team adjustments (extend/narrow).
- Support resource planning (and independently use the planning tool once available).
- Support SAP project resource planning (roles profiles demand forecasting).
Delivery Quality & Estimation
- Review and approve manday estimations prepared by the team.
- Ensure proposal quality and appropriate delegation of subtasks.
- Manage smaller delivery/professional escalations independently; manage smaller HR-related escalations as needed.
- Collaborate with manager and HR on bigger or repeated escalations.
- Lead SAP project delivery from initiation to closure including scope timeline budget and quality control.
- Ensure compliance with SAP Activate or relevant project methodology.
- Drive issue and risk management for SAP workstreams.
- Support functional/technical design reviews and solution quality assurance.
Hiring Onboarding & Junior Program
- Participate in professional interviews and the hiring process.
- Define the number and skillset of juniors to hire; contribute to training/mentoring plans.
- Arrange/support a junior program in coordination with trainers/mentors.
- Evaluate SAP candidate profiles during hiring (functional/technical fit consulting skills).
Communication Governance & Reporting
- Cascade organizational messages to the team as requested by management.
- Ensure proper time reporting at least on a monthly basis.
- Provide regular news and status updates to the manager on team members and deliveries.
- Collaborate with other functional areas and professional teams to remove blockers and align practices.
- Provide expert-level SAP project reporting (milestones risks dependencies).
Planning & Budget Support
- Support the manager in yearly budget planning (inputs on capacity roles/levels and development plans).
- Provide input for SAP project budgeting cost forecasting and effort planning.
Qualifications
General Requirements
- Bachelors degree (or equivalent experience) in a relevant field.
- 5 years of relevant professional experience; 2 years in team/line management preferred.
- Proven capacity/resource planning and estimation experience.
- Demonstrated delivery/governance and quality management experience.
- Solid record in performance management and coaching.
- Confident stakeholder and escalation management.
- Tooling familiarity: time reporting capacity planning project tracking (e.g. Jira Azure DevOps) and office productivity tools.
- Language: German (fluent) ; English (fluent)
Senior SAP Project Manager Requirements
- 710 years of SAP project management experience (implementation rollout upgrade or transformation projects).
- Demonstrated success leading full-cycle SAP ERP or S/4HANA projects.
- Strong understanding of SAP modules integration points and cross-functional processes.
- Hands-on experience with SAP Activate ASAP or equivalent methodologies.
- Proven ability to manage multi-disciplinary SAP teams (functional technical basis integration testing).
- Experience in stakeholder management for SAP programs (business IT partners vendors).
- Risk issue change request and scope management expertise within SAP programs.
- Ability to support solution design validate estimates and challenge technical/functional assumptions.
- SAP certification (Activate / PMP / Prince2) is an advantage.

Success Metrics (KPIs)
Delivery
- On-time delivery rate
- Quality (defects rework)
- SAP project milestone adherence
- Customer/internal satisfaction
Capacity
- Utilization balance
- Forecast accuracy
- Staffing lead time
People
- Performance cycle completion
- Development plan execution
- Retention
Governance
- Time reporting completeness/timeliness
- Escalation resolution time
Talent
- Hiring velocity (juniors SAP profiles)
- Time-to-productivity
